Bleeding after vaginal delivery ?

I delivard my beautiful girl the 21st no drugs at all no pain medicine during or now that I'm home and the first time I went to pee it was lots of blood like I murdered someone in the potty ! Lol now I'm still bleeding just not as bad I put a pretty big overnight pad on at 11 last night it was full by 8 this morning this is normal right? There isn't much blood in the toilet you can see the bottom. How long will bleeding last?

You will bleed for about six to seven weeks after having a baby. Its normal.

And the bleeding varies for everyone. Some bleed 6 weeks some bleed 8 weeks. But normally it decreases in heaviness as time goes on.

You have 9 months of periods to account for..so yes its normal however, if you begin soaking completely through an overnight/ super heavy pad in 2 hours then u need to go to the emergency room.
